zoukankan      html  css  js  c++  java
  • MYSQL5.5源码包编译安装

    MYSQL5.5源码安装
    首先安装必要的库
    yum -y install gcc*
    ###### 安装 MYSQL ######
    首先安装camke
    一、支持YUM,则
    yum install -y cmake
    二、也可以源码安装
    cd /usr/local/src
    #下载cmake
    wget http://www.cmake.org/files/v2.8/cmake-2.8.7.tar.gz
    tar zxvf cmake-2.8.7.tar.gz
    cd cmake-2.8.7
    #安装cmake
    ./configure
    make
    make install
    安装 MYSQL
    官网下载 MYSQL5.5版本 linux下源码包
    http://dev.mysql.com/downloads/
    创建用户及组并解压包
    useradd -M mysql -s /sbin/nologin
    tar zxvf mysql-5.2.25.tar.gz
    cd mysql-5.2.25
    #cmake .//默认情况下安装,安装目录为/usr/local/mysql 数据目录为/usr/local/mysql/data
    #也可以指定参数安装,如指定UTF8,数据引擎等
    cmake -DCMAKE_INSTALL_PREFIX=/usr/local/mysql
    -DMYSQL_DATADIR=/mysql/data -DDEFAULT_CHARSET=utf8
    -DDEFAULT_COLLATION=utf8_general_ci
    -DWITH_EXTRA_CHARSETS:STRING=all
    -DWITH_DEBUG=0 -DWITH_SSL=yes
    -DWITH_READLINE=1 -DENABLED_LOCAL_INFILE=1
    make && make install
    进入安装目录
    cd /usr/local/mysql
    chown -R mysql:mysql /usr/local/mysql
    初始化
    ./scripts/mysql_install_db --user=mysql -datadir=/mysql/data
    #此处如不指定datadir,到启动时会报错
    拷备配置文件及启动脚本
    cp support-files/my-medium.cnf /etc/my.cnf
    cp support-files/mysql.server /etc/init.d/mysqld
    chmod +x /etc/init.d/mysqld
    启动mysql服务
    /etc/init.d/mysqld start
    到此,安装完成

  • 相关阅读:
    什么是restful风格?
    android中设置控件获得焦点
    Android中Parcelable的原理和使用方法
    webstorm快捷键大全
    HTTP状态码
    三行代码写爬虫
    HTTrackPortable
    安装mac系统
    Vue常用的操作指令
    什么样的人不适合当程序员呢?
  • 原文地址:https://www.cnblogs.com/ddgen/p/7103212.html
Copyright © 2011-2022 走看看